The 2025 Future of Education Report, by our GoStudent partner

Recently, the GoStudent group (of which FindTutors is a part) conducted its yearly future of education study throughout Europe, surveying 5,859 parents and children, along with roughly 300 teachers.

The conclusion is undeniable: AI is no longer an emerging trend but an increasingly integral part of the educational system. We found a strong and unified demand for transformative changes across education: from the skills taught at school to the technologies utilised to how learning is assessed and accessed. The imperative for education to advance in tandem with technological progress is clear.

In the past, parents and teachers were showing concerns about integrating technology at school. In 2025, these initial reluctances have given way to a focus on the responsible use of online tools. Misinformation and excessive screen time could become an issue for children learning online, leading teachers to ask for AI-training.

Key takeaways from our Education Report

Technology and AI are gaining ground in the education landscape

The development of AI is challenging education: 22% of teachers believe that subjects such as computer science are not fit for the future anymore and should be replaced by other skills that could be more useful for students' future careers.

In the UK, 56% of parents think their children spend too much time on devices while 47% admit to using them to do their homework. The always-online generation is progressively leading to the decline of traditional education.

With 70% of teachers in the UK predicting a central role of AI in their students' professional careers, they recommend the integration of technology into schools.

About FindTutors

FindTutors is an education platform that helps students and teachers connect.

Founded in 2007 by Albert Clemente in Barcelona and acquired by GoStudent in 2022, FindTutors has continued to grow and evolve to best meet students' needs.

Thousands of tutors offer private online and offline classes for more than 350 subjects on our website.
